Andy Summers and Jack Wilkins duo at the 1997 Benedetto Players Concert on Long Island, New York. (Classic American Guitar Show weekend). Andy plays a green custom Manhattan made for Benedetto’s daughter Gina in 1995. Jack plays his Fratello model. Fantastic photo by Norman Wilson.

ANIMA E CORPO (Body and Soul) custom 7-String commissioned by Bill Doyle in 1995 incorporated signatures of 80 great jazz guitarists including Tony Mottola, Johnny Smith, Les Paul, George Benson, Kenny Burrell, Pat Martino and 74 more! Serial #47202
